Templar render times regressed 40% after the Oakhollow partials refactor. Cache hit rate fell because fragment keys now include request locale even when templates are locale-agnostic. Proposed fix: strip locale from the key unless the template opts in. Needs decision at sync — Vexley wants the opt-in flag, Marden wants a revert. Repro numbers came from the run whose token is below.

build token for kagaf-hahof: htk14_9d3d4d26d7d8de

## Roll out Crumbclear consent banner to all regions

Heads up, support folks: this PR flips the Crumbclear banner on for everyone, not just the Valemoor pilot. Users will see it once per device until they choose; dismissals re-prompt after the grace window. If someone reports the banner looping, it's almost always a blocked storage issue — there's a canned reply in the macros. Rollout is staged over three days with an auto-halt on error spikes. Pacing constants are below.

tuning table, hawip-yaweg:
WEIGHTS = {
    "oliwyn": 954,
    "gilath": 470,
    "kelys": 463,
}

## Authentication

The Rowlight seat-map renderer for the Pellam Court Theatre pulls venue geometry from the internal Stagegrid service at build time. Release builds must authenticate; anonymous access is disabled outside the dev sandbox. The renderer reads its credential from the `STAGEGRID_KEY` environment variable, which should be set in the release pipeline before the bundle step. Rotation happens quarterly, so confirm validity before tagging. For the current release cycle, use the key below.

app token of bahaf-tajeg = zpat23_SjjsllwiLmXbtS65veZaV47